WebOct 1, 2015 · Traditional coherence-enhancing diffusion filtering (CED) completes the interrupted lines and gaps but at the cost of reducing the contrast between coherent structures and the background. In this study, we introduce a source term into CED filtering to restore the initial image and the contrast lost by pure diffusion filters. WebMar 10, 2014 · Download PDF Abstract: We demonstrate a method for filtering images defined on curved surfaces embedded in 3D. Applications are noise removal and the creation of artistic effects. Our approach relies on in-surface diffusion: we formulate Weickert's edge/coherence enhancing diffusion models in a surface-intrinsic way. WebJan 1, 2016 · Coherence-enhancing diffusion filtering is a striking application of the anisotropic diffusion in image processing. The technique deals with the problem of completion of interrupted lines and enhancement of flow-like features in fingerprint images.
